Canada Seems To Be A Great Market For Indian Channels, ATN Ties Up With Aastha TV

C21 Media.net: Canada seems to be a great market for Indian TV channels. Close on the heels of airing India’s NDTV in Canada, Asian Television Network has picked up the distribution of Hindi-language station Aastha TV, a channel that currently reaches over 20 million households worldwide, carried across Asia, Africa, Australia, Europe and the USA.
The Aastha TV offers programs on spiritual discourses, cultural ceremonies and events, meditation techniques and devotional music. It has content on the holy places of pilgrimage, traditional festivals, Indian Vedic sciences like ayurveda, yoga, astrology, crystal therapy and aromatherapy.
ATN is now planning to grow its bouquet of foreign-language services with 14 more digital TV channels, for which licences were granted by Canada
